I'm thinking specifically of using `find-file' on what you think is a
non-existent file, and discovering that the buffer has non-empty
content because the file has been checked out of RCS. I would not
call that "explicitly calling VC functions".
That is true. However, in that case, given the way RCS is used, I
think that checking out the file is the right thing to do.
